1) First, the new LA restaurant Picca, a Peruvian paradise of sorts.

This type of fare is supposedly the newest sought-after cuisine in LA.  If you’re into morsels of marinated beef on skewers, or sweet potatoes with honey and fresh lime…

…or leche de tigre, a Peruvian type of ceviche known as an elixir (trust me; I’ve seen my uncle and Peruvian aunt eat this stuff and act like horny teenagers afterwards) – then you gotta check out this place.  9575 West Pico Blvd, LA, CA 90035.  (310) 277-0133
